Merced College is a midsized community college located in California’s Central Valley. Founded in 1962, the College serves more than 16,000 students annually with room to expand on its 267-acre main Merced campus and 120 acre Los Banos campus site. The City of Merced, incorporated in 1889, offers historical sites, affordable housing, access to the Bay Area and Sacramento, and it is the Gateway to Yosemite National Park and the Sierra mountains as well as home to the University of California Merced campus. Our tree-shaded, growing community of just over 80,000 includes multiple biking and walking trails as well as access to several lakes – large and small – throughout the county.

General Description:
This is a full-time, nontenure track and categorically funded assignment in the General Counseling Department at Merced College under the direction of the Dean of Student Services. The incumbent will be responsible for the provision of counseling and support services to students enrolled in Merced Community College District, and in maintaining legal compliance with all district policies, as well as all State and Federal mandates
